MERC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

95 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Mercer International (MERC)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$558M — up 25% from $448M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 15 funds closed out of MERC and 10 opened new positions — a net loss of 5 holders — while 35 trimmed existing stakes and 29 added.

The largest buyer was Portolan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$2.22M. The largest seller was Acadian Asset Management, cutting an estimated $2.45M.
